February 15, 2021 - Last of the 08's. This 13 year old Stellenbosch "Fusion" of just over 55% cabernet is really quite good. Very rounded tonight and the structure of these wines is always pretty impeccable. I still believe that this one would reward you with an incredible experience in five years, but right now this one is slamming good. Enters with a clove compote, black roasted fruits, some bacon fat, a little BBQ potato chip with salinity. The DeToren Fusion (and really DeToren in general) seems to have this character regardless of the vintage. This wine still has a lot of life, although I'm not sure about upside potential. Definitely seems to have more of a rounded quality than the last bottle, but nowhere near the critical "drink now or else" phase.

November 30, 2020 - Another example of what happens when you allow South African wine to mature. Deep garnet colour. Alluring nose with hints of cedar and dark fruit including plum. Faintest hint of Feinbos. Lovely balanced taste with plenty of complexity with good Claret flavour and balancing acidity and minerals. Good but not exceptional length.
In a very good place now -
